United Cerebral Palsy of Georgia is looking for a dedicated Activities Coordinator to join our team in Greater London. Your primary responsibility will be to plan, deliver, and evaluate engaging entertainment programs tailored for our residents. This role includes facilitating group activities as well as one-on-one interactions. We are committed to providing a high standard of care and creating a comfortable, welcoming environment that promotes independence and choice.
